Cece created this cache as GC3BF9, but then disappeared from the
Geocaching scene. We tried to adopt the original listing, but
"forced" adoptions are no longer allowed. The only way forward
was to archive the original listing and submit a new one in its
place.
The coordinates on the original listing were bad from the
start and were never corrected. The original plastic container
broke down over the years and was only recently replaced by a
considerate finder. The coordinates listed now should be correct
according to JohnMac56 and Frog &
Polywog.
Since this is a new cache listing, the old logs from the
original cache do not automatically carry over. To preserve the
cache's find-history, previous finders are encouraged to copy your
log from the old cache and claim a find on this one. Please
back-date the find log to when you originally found it. Original
description below:
Cece's geocache is hidden on the side of a small hill on the
east side of the road - a fairly easy walk is required to find the
geocache. There's a series of knee-high stone walls on the side of
the hill - the geocache is hidden in one of them.
The geocache is hidden at 935' and has a killer view of the
desert and Ford Dry Lake to the north.
